Talent Watch - Hiring Manager Relations 08.06.2020 11:48
Having effective hiring managers is crucial for businesses looking to hire and develop the talent they need. For nearly 90% of job seekers, it is the impression they get of the person they will be working for that most influences their decision on whether to join.
